        Biosequestration, Transformation, and Volatilization of Mercury by Lysinibacillus fusiformis Isolated from Industrial Effluent

        ( Gupta Saurabh ),( Richa Goyal ),( Jashan Nirwan ),( Swaranjit Singh Cameotra ),( Nagaraja Tejoprakash ) 한국미생물 · 생명공학회 2012 Journal of microbiology and biotechnology Vol.22 No.5

        In the present study, an efficient mercury-tolerant bacterial strain (RS-5) was isolated from heavy-metalcontaminated industrial effluent. Under shake flask conditions, 97% of the supplemented mercuric chloride was sequestered by the biomass of RS-5 grown in a tryptone soy broth. The sequestered mercuric ions were transformed inside the bacterial cells, as an XRD analysis of the biomass confirmed the formation of mercurous chloride, which is only feasible following the reaction of the elemental mercury and the residual mercuric chloride present within the cells. Besides the sequestration and intracellular transformation, a significant fraction of the mercury (63%) was also volatilized. The 16S rRNA gene sequence of RS-5 revealed its phylogenetic relationship with the family Bacillaceae, and a 98% homology with Lysinibacillus fusiformis, a Gram-positive bacterium with swollen sporangia. This is the first observation of the sequestration and volatilization of mercuric ions by Lysinibacillus sp.

        Hemitruncus Arteriosus With Anomalous Origin of the Right Coronary Artery From the Right Pulmonary Artery and Unilateral Absence of the Left Pulmonary Artery

        Mohini Gupta,Viralam S Kiran,Suraj Gowda,Richa Kothari,Vimal Raj 아시아심장혈관영상의학회 2024 Cardiovascular Imaging Asia Vol.8 No.2

        Hemitruncus arteriosus, anomalous origin of a pulmonary artery from the aorta, is a rare congenital heart disease frequently accompanied by other cardiovascular anomalies. In this case report, we present an exceedingly rare case of hemitruncus arteriosus in an 18-year-old male patient presenting with cyanosis and chest pain. Echocardiography raised a suspicion for aorto-pulmonary window; this was confirmed on cardiac computed tomography angiography. A magnetic resonance imaging study was performed for functional assessment. The resulting diagnosis was hemitruncus arteriosus with aberrant origin of the right coronary artery from the right pulmonary artery and unilateral absence of a pulmonary artery.

        Therapeutic Value of Hippophae rhamnoides L. Against Subchronic Arsenic Toxicity in Mice

        S.J.S. Flora,Richa Gupta 한국식품영양과학회 2005 Journal of medicinal food Vol.8 No.3

        The present study was planned to investigate the therapeutic efficacy of Hippophae rhamnoides L. against the toxic effects of arsenic in mice. H. rhamnoides L. is used as an herbal remedy for gastric ulcers, burns, and some skin and allergic diseases. Twenty-five Swiss albino mice were exposed to arsenic (25 ppm) in drinking water for 3 months. After 3 months different fruit extracts of H. rhamnoides L. (500 mg/kg for 10 days) were administered, the animals were sacrificed,and blood and tissues were assayed for various biochemical indicators of oxidative stress and whether arsenic was removed from tissues. Treatment with different fruit extracts of H. rhamnoides L. showed significant protection from arsenic inhibition of blood -aminolevulinic acid dehydratase activity and restored blood reduced glutathione levels. Other hematologic variables like white blood cell counts, hemoglobin, and hematocrit were partially protected by supplementation with a water extract of H. rhamnoides L. (HF-WRT). Significant protection was also observed in altered hepatic, renal, and brain reduced/oxidized glutathione ratio and thiobarbituric acid-reactive substances levels. The aqueous extract of H. rhamnoides L.(HF-WRT) also provided protection against parameters indicative of liver injury such as aspartate aminotransferase, alanine aminotransferase, and alkaline phosphatase activities. There was also no effect on blood and tissue arsenic concentrations observed except some moderate depletion of blood arsenic concentrations, suggesting that the drug has no ability to chelate intracellular arsenic. It can be concluded from these results that post-treatment with an aqueous extract of H. rhamnoides L. (HF-WRT) significantly protects against arsenic-induced oxidative stress but does not chelate arsenic, suggesting it may have a beneficial role as a supplementing agent during chelation of arsenic by other means.

        Cadaveric anatomy of the lumbar triangular safe zone of Kambin’s in North West Indian population

        Chiman Kumari,Tulika Gupta,Richa Gupta,Vishal Kumar,Daisy Sahni,Anjali Aggarwal,Neelkamal 대한해부학회 2021 Anatomy & Cell Biology Vol.54 No.1

        A three dimensional triangular space ‘the Kambin’s triangle (KT)’ present on the dorsolateral aspect of the intervertebral disc, is considered to be a safe area for transforaminal approaches. It allows access to the exiting and traversing nerve roots, the thecal sac and to the intervertebral disc spaces. Our aim was to calculate the area of the triangle by measuring the height and base at all the intervertebral spaces bilaterally in the lumbar region in North West Indian cadavers and to assess the diameter of circle inscribed within this triangle which will correspond to the size of cannula inserted for the minimally invasive transforaminal approaches in this population. Five randomly chosen adult cadavers were used for this study. After clearing the area, the exiting nerve was identified. The height and base of the bony KTs (n=40) were measured with the help of digital Vernier’s calliper (accuracy 0.02 mm) to calculate the area of the KT. There is a steady increase in the area of the bony KT reaching maximum at the level of L4-5 intervertebral space. Statistically there were no differencesin the calculated areas between right and left side. The mean diameter of inscribed circle within the triangle also showed gradual increase from 5.82 mm at L1-2 level, reaching maximum value of 7.26 mm at L4-5 level on the right side while on the left side the values were 5.66 mm and 8.16 mm respectively. Careful anatomical consideration is of utmost importance in transforaminal approaches during surgical or interventional procedures in this region. Cannula having external diameter ranging 6–8 mm is recommended for any interventional approach through Kambin’s space.

      • Shelterin Proteins and Cancer

        Patel, Trupti NV,Vasan, Richa,Gupta, Divanshu,Patel, Jay,Trivedi, Manjari Asian Pacific Journal of Cancer Prevention 2015 Asian Pacific journal of cancer prevention Vol.16 No.8

        The telomeric end structures of the DNA are known to contain tandem repeats of TTAGGG sequence bound with specialised protein complex called the "shelterin complex". It comprises six proteins, namely TRF1, TRF2, TIN2, POT1, TPP1 and RAP1. All of these assemble together to form a complex with double strand and single strand DNA repeats at the telomere. Such an association contributes to telomere stability and its protection from undesirable DNA damage control-specific responses. However, any alteration in the structure and function of any of these proteins may lead to undesirable DNA damage responses and thus cellular senescence and death. In our review, we throw light on how mutations in the proteins belonging to the shelterin complex may lead to various malfunctions and ultimately have a role in tumorigenesis and cancer progression.

        Fetomaternal outcomes in pregnant women with congenital heart disease: a comparative analysis from an apex institute

        Soniya Dhiman,Aparna Sharma,Akanksha Gupta,Richa Vatsa,Juhi Bharti,Vidushi Kulshrestha,Satyavir Yadav,Vatsla Dadhwal,Neena Malhotra 대한산부인과학회 2024 Obstetrics & Gynecology Science Vol.67 No.2

        Objective With advancements in cardiac surgical interventions during infancy and childhood, the incidence of maternal congenital heart disease (CHD) is increasing. This retrospective study compared fetal and cardiac outcomes in women with and without CHD, along with a sub-analysis between cyanotic versus non-cyanotic defects and operated versus non-operated cases.Methods A 10-year data were retrospectively collected from pregnant women with CHD and a 1:1 ratio of pregnant women without any heart disease. Adverse fetal and cardiac outcomes were noted in both groups. Statistical significance was set at <i>P</i><0.05.Results A total of 86 pregnant women with CHD were studied, with atrial septal defects (29.06%) being the most common. Out of 86 participants, 27 (31.39%) had cyanotic CHD. Around 55% of cases were already operated on for their cardiac defects. Among cardiovascular complications, 5.8% suffered from heart failure, 7.0% had pulmonary arterial hypertension, 8.1% presented in New York Heart Association functional class IV, 9.3% had a need for intensive care unit admission, and one experienced maternal mortality. Adverse fetal outcomes, including operative vaginal delivery, mean duration of hospital stay, fetal growth restriction, preterm birth (<37 weeks), low birth weight (<2,500 g), 5-minute APGAR score <7, and neonatal intensive care unit admissions, were significantly higher in women with CHD than in women without heart disease.Conclusion Women with CHD have a higher risk of adverse fetal and cardiac outcomes. The outcome can be improved with proper pre-conceptional optimization of the cardiac condition, good antenatal care, and multidisciplinary team management.         Effects of glenohumeral corticosteroid injection on stiffness following arthroscopic rotator cuff repair: a prospective, multicentric, case-control study with 18-month follow-up

        Amyn M. Rajani,Urvil A Shah,Anmol RS Mittal,Sheetal Gupta,Rajesh Garg,Alisha A. Rajani,Gautam Shetty,Meenakshi Punamiya,Richa Singhal 대한견주관절학회 2023 대한견주관절의학회지 Vol.26 No.1

        Background: This study aimed to analyze the efficacy of single-dose corticosteroid injection (CSI) administered at 6 weeks postoperative to treat stiffness following arthroscopic rotator cuff repair (ARCR). Methods: In this prospective, multicentric, case-control study, post-ARCR stiffness at 6 weeks was treated with either a single dose of intra-articular CSI (CSI group) or physical therapy with oral analgesics (non-CSI group). Pain intensity according to visual analog scale (VAS), functional outcome using the Constant Murley Shoulder Score, time to return to activities of daily living (ADLs), and retear rate were recorded at 6 weeks, 9 weeks, 12 weeks, 6 months, 12 months, and 18 months postoperatively in both groups. Results: A total of 149 patients (54.5%) in the CSI group and 124 patients (45.5%) in the non-CSI group were included in this study. Pain and function were significantly better in the CSI group at 9-week, 12-week, and 6-month (P<0.001) follow-up, whereas they were not significantly different when the groups were compared at 12- and 18-month follow-up. The mean duration to return to ADLs was significantly shorter (P<0.001) in the CSI group. The incidence of retears was not significantly different (P=0.36) between groups at the end of 18 months of follow-up. Conclusions: Single-dose intra-articular CSI administered at 6 weeks postoperative to treat post-ARCR stiffness significantly improved pain, function, and duration of return to ADLs without increasing the risk of retears compared to patients who did not receive intra-articular CSI.
